Subject: [PATCH v2] bcachefs: Align the display format of `btrees/inodes/keys`

Before patch:
```
#cat btrees/inodes/keys
u64s 17 type inode_v3 0:4096:U32_MAX len 0 ver 0: mode=40755
flags= (16300000)
bi_size=0
```
After patch:
```
#cat btrees/inodes/keys
u64s 17 type inode_v3 0:4096:U32_MAX len 0 ver 0:
mode=40755
flags=(16300000)
bi_size=0
```
Signed-off-by: Youling Tang <tangyouling@kylinos.cn>
---
v2:
- Adjust where to add new lines of code.
- Remove flags ` ` by Hongbo suggestion.
fs/bcachefs/inode.c | 3 ++-
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/fs/bcachefs/inode.c b/fs/bcachefs/inode.c
index f0da2b0048cc..5c9ee41baa72 100644
--- a/fs/bcachefs/inode.c
+++ b/fs/bcachefs/inode.c
@@ -534,12 +534,13 @@ int bch2_inode_v3_invalid(struct bch_fs *c, struct bkey_s_c k,
static void __bch2_inode_unpacked_to_text(struct printbuf *out,
struct bch_inode_unpacked *inode)
{
+ prt_printf(out, "\n");
printbuf_indent_add(out, 2);
prt_printf(out, "mode=%o\n", inode->bi_mode);
prt_str(out, "flags=");
prt_bitflags(out, bch2_inode_flag_strs, inode->bi_flags & ((1U << 20) - 1));
- prt_printf(out, " (%x)\n", inode->bi_flags);
+ prt_printf(out, "(%x)\n", inode->bi_flags);
prt_printf(out, "journal_seq=%llu\n", inode->bi_journal_seq);
prt_printf(out, "bi_size=%llu\n", inode->bi_size);
